COVID-19: WHO halts hydroxychloroquine, HIV drugs in COVID trials after failure to reduce deathGENEVA, July 4 (Reuters) - The World Health Organization (WHO) said on Saturday that it was discontinuing its trials of the malaria drug hydroxychloroquine and combination HIV drug lopinavir/ritonavir in hospitalised patients with COVID-19 after they failed to reduce mortality.
